Salary Trajectory for Data Analysts in Northport (2021–2027)
2021–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 4.48%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2021 | $28,917 | Actual |
| 2022 | $28,469 | Actual |
| 2023 | $29,715 | Actual |
| 2024 | $43,809 | Actual |
| 2025 | $32,717 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$34,183 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$35,714 | Projected |
Entry-level data analyst compensation (10th percentile) in Northport, AL grew 13.1% over 5 years based on actual BLS metropolitan area surveys, rising from $28,917 in 2021 to $32,717 in 2025. By 2027, starting salaries are projected to reach $35,714. New graduates entering the Northport job market can expect continued year-over-year gains.
Note: Historical values (2021–2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Northport met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026–2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 4.48% CAGR derived from 5-year BLS historical data.
